The inaugural Pemberton Festival, a huge show 30 minutes north of Whistler, BC, goes on sale Friday.
The bill has impressive headliners: Coldplay, Nine Inch Nails, Jay-Z, Tom Petty, Death Cab for Cutie and the Flaming Lips, to name my favorites. For a Snohomish County resident, the three-day festival could rival Sasquatch, which is closer but still a drive.
Along with that show, tickets for Dave Matthews Band and She Wants Revenge are set to go on sale.
Here’s a glance at those shows and more. I’ll update this as I learn of other shows. Ticket prices don’t include random service charges, parking fees, etc.
Pemberton Festival at the Pemberton Festival Grounds, Pemberton, BC, $239.50 Canadian, which converts almost equally to about $236 US. This is an early bird sale for three-day passes. Tickets likely will increase in price after supplies sell out. Tickets for the July 25-27 festival on sale Friday.
Carrie Underwood at the Puyallup Fair and Events Center, Puyallup, presale from now to 9:59 a.m. Saturday, $50 to $75. Presale password is “wolf.” Tickets for the Sept. 19 show on sale to the general public at 10 a.m. Saturday.
She Wants Revenge at the Showbox at the Market, Seattle, presale from 10 a.m. to 10 p.m. Friday, $20. Sorry, I don’t have a presale password yet. Tickets for the June 18 show on sale to the general public at 10 a.m. Saturday.
Pat Green at the Showbox at the Market, Seattle, presale from 10 a.m. to 10 p.m. Friday, $22.50. Password is “showbox.” Tickets for the July 11 show on sale to the general public at 10 a.m. Saturday.
Dave Matthews Band at the Gorge Ampitheatre, George, $48.50 to $70. Tickets for the Aug. 29 show on sale to the general public at 9 a.m. Saturday.
